Our students had an unforgettable three days in London, packed with culture, history and unforgettable experiences. From exploring the vibrant streets of Chinatown and Soho, to taking in breathtaking views from The Garden at 120, the trip began with excitement and curiosity from the very first day.

Students stepped back in time at the Tower of London, walked iconic routes across London Bridge, and soaked up the atmosphere of the South Bank. A highlight for many was an evening at the theatre, enjoying a spectacular performance of Hercules in London’s West End.

The final day continued the adventure with hands-on learning at the Natural History Museum, a walk past world-famous landmarks, and visits to Harrods and the historic Cutty Sark.
